Roger to play Davis Cup
16.08.2008 | Tennis
Roger explained in Beijing today that he will not only be helping Switzerland in the World Group Play-offs of the Davis Cup against Belgium (September 19 - 21 in Lausanne, Switzerland) but also in the first round of 2009.
He has not quite made all his plans for the coming season but says that "In general next year will certainly be easier. I will certainly join the team for the first round."
In order to focus fully on his singles career Roger has had to skip the first round of the season since 2005. Up until 2007 the Swiss then went on to lose and had to play the relegation, where Roger then helped out.
